Japanese pruning, also known as "Niwaki," is a traditional technique that offers numerous benefits for your garden or landscape. This method focuses on creating natural and aesthetically pleasing shapes by selectively pruning branches and foliage. Japanese pruning enhances the overall health and appearance of trees and shrubs, promoting better growth and longevity. By removing dead or diseased branches, it improves air circulation and sunlight penetration, reducing the risk of pests and diseases. Additionally, Japanese pruning encourages the development of strong branch structures, making trees more resistant to wind and storms. The precise and meticulous approach of Japanese pruning results in beautifully sculpted plants that add elegance and tranquility to any outdoor space.
Japanese Pruning, also known as "Niwaki," is a traditional horticultural practice originating from Japan that focuses on the art of shaping and training trees and shrubs. This specialized pruning technique emphasizes aesthetics while maintaining the health and vitality of the plants. The philosophy behind Japanese Pruning revolves around creating natural and harmonious forms, often inspired by the shapes found in nature. By carefully sculpting the plants, Japanese Pruning enhances their overall beauty and creates a sense of tranquility in the garden. This meticulous approach to pruning involves precise cuts, selective thinning, and strategic shaping, resulting in carefully crafted living sculptures that can transform any garden into a serene and visually stunning space.
